Walschaerts valve gear
Type of valve gear / From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
The Walschaerts valve gear is a type of valve gear used to regulate the flow of steam to the pistons in steam locomotives, invented by Belgian railway engineer Egide Walschaerts in 1844.[1] [2] The gear is sometimes named without the final "s",[lower-alpha 1] since it was incorrectly patented under that name. It was extensively used in steam locomotives from the late 19th century until the end of the steam era.
